Findomestic bank left Stock Exchange

Vice President of the Executive Board of Findomestic bank in Serbia, Vladimir Marković, said that the stocks of that bank had been excluded from the trading on the Belgrade Stock Exchange because it had become the closed stock company.

He pointed out that, due to flexibility of corporate management, which is enabled by the closing of the company, that was a logical move of the stockholders of Findomestic Bank.

Stockholders of Findomestic bank are two large banking groups - "BNP Paribas" and Banca Intesa, which are present on other stock exchanges.

Findomestic bought 97% of stocks of Nova Banka from Belgrade 2 years ago for 22.5m EUR.

Stocks of Nova Banka were procured at the price of 19,759 RSD, that is, 230.4 EUR per stock.

The last value of the stock with the voting right was 18,015 RSD. Stocks of Nova Banka entered the stock exchange market on June 8, 2005.

There was no trading in stocks of Nova Banka and, later, Findomestic banka, although they were in demand occasionally.
